Output 59b22a36de81b89189fde908a5b22449f18f70187d0913f8715166dd184555ef:1

value
29593749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b3328e738daa20de98ea5a6082dcf8cc7ba266 OP_EQUAL
address
37xGYSvn5q1PsmgAVbe8zn3YRdfxHe9Xv8
transaction
59b22a36de81b89189fde908a5b22449f18f70187d0913f8715166dd184555ef
spent
true